Why Watervliet Property Owners Need the Right Policy

Watervliet has a mix of owner and renter-occupied homes, with only 35.2% owner-occupied—meaning many properties face risks from fire and water damage due to aging infrastructure.

Rents are stable but growing: current asking rents in Watervliet average about $1,600–$1,700 across all bedroom counts, according to recent marketplace trackers (Zillow & Zumper). Protecting against fire-related losses is essential for property maintenance.

Older buildings are prevalent: roughly 55.3% of housing units were built before 1960, which correlates with higher risk from aging wiring, older plumbing, and legacy construction methods—key factors for dwelling fire forms.

Flood risks are notable: Proximity to the Hudson River means Watervliet faces potential flooding from heavy rain and river overflow. Even if your property isn’t in a FEMA 100-year zone, consider NFIP or private flood alongside your dwelling fire policy.

Coverage Options for Watervliet Property Owners

Dwelling Fire Forms

  • DP-1 (Basic): Named perils; ACV (Actual Cash Value) on many losses. Best for lower-value or vacant properties.
  • DP-2 (Broad): Adds perils like falling objects, weight of ice/snow, and accidental discharge of water; often a solid baseline.
  • DP-3 (Special): Open perils on the dwelling with exclusions; commonly preferred for well-maintained properties.

Essential Add-Ons

  • Liability Coverage: Protects against claims; consider limits based on property use.
  • Extended Coverage: For fire-related losses, including water damage from firefighting.
  • Ordinance or Law: Covers code upgrades for older structures.
  • Water Backup: Important for areas near rivers.
  • Flood: NFIP or private flood for Hudson River exposure.
  • Equipment Breakdown: Covers systems like heating and electrical.

DP-1 vs DP-2 vs DP-3 (Quick Compare)

FeatureDP-1DP-2DP-3
Peril scopeBasic named perilsBroad named perilsSpecial (open perils) on dwelling
SettlementOften ACVACV or RC (varies)Typically RC (with conditions)
Water (accidental discharge)Usually excludedIncludedIncluded (subject to exclusions)
Best fitLower cost, limited needsBalanced protectionWell-maintained properties
